A Chain Chomp Capsule is a capsule appearing only in Mario Party 5. It can be thrown onto a space on the board, or used on the player for fifteen coins. When somebody lands on a space containing this capsule, a Chain Chomp appears. He steals coins from opponents for free and a Star for 30 coins. This is like Boo from past Mario Party games (via the Boo Bell or the Boo's Crystal Ball), though the price for a Star is 20 coins cheaper and he usually does not steal many coins.
